This sounds dumb I know. I know there are a million posts about the lack of engine cover on the newer sports, but I couldn't find the answer to this question anywhere. Can you take an engine cover from the '21 and install it on the '22? Same trim level. I think it has 2 areas to screw it in, and didn't know if those would even be there on the '22 model.

Yeah, you just need the little bolts for it - I ordered and installed all the parts, took about 5 minutes on my 22 OBX.
